Carney Says Greek Debt Relief May Be Part of Solution

Mark Carney

Bank of Canada Governor Mark Carney said additional debt relief for Greece may be part of a way to help ease economic adjustment for the Mediterranean country.
In an interview with Sun News Network to be broadcast at 6 p.m. Ottawa time, Carney said the International Monetary Fund and the European Union are trying to “smooth that path and lessen the adjustment as much as possible.”
“It is the current view that there is a way, through a combination of money through the IMF and European authorities, additional measures by the Greeks, maybe some additional debt relief, that that is the best path for Greece,” said Carney, according to a transcript provided by Sun News.
Carney, who is also the chairman of the Financial Stability Board charged by Group of 20 leaders to coordinate global financial reforms, said Europe is the biggest risk to the global economy in the “medium-term” because of the challenges associated with “re-creating” the region’s monetary union.
